VDS_E_SECURITY_INCOMPLETELY_SET

VDS_E_SECURITY_INCOMPLETELY_SET likewise reports partial application of portal security configuration. The result is especially important because a mixed state can leave different iSCSI paths using different authentication or IPsec policy.

Audit effective security per path

  • Read back portal and initiator security configuration after the batch operation.
  • Identify which portals are active in existing target sessions.
  • Correct failed entries before relying on multipath failover or removing the old security settings.

Do not repeat the whole batch blindly, because already-updated paths can reject credentials or policy intended for the previous configuration. Microsoft marks several VDS IPsec methods as unsupported/reserved, so also verify that the requested feature is implemented on the target Windows release and provider.
